【SVN】新SVN项目的注意事项
2015-03-10 08:41
148 查看
一个真正的网页编程程序猿走上团队协作的道路是不可避免的,使用Eclipse或者MyEclipse利用SVN插件完成团队编程总有一天或者就是现在,是一件很平常的事情。
但是,往往有时候前台环境配置好了,《【Javaweb】前台开发环境的配置Myeclipse6.5+JDK1.6+Tomcat6.0+SVN1.8》(点击打开链接),后台环境配置好,《【Mysql】Mysql的安装、部署与图形化》(点击打开链接),各步骤都做好了,根据上面给的SVN从服务器按照要求Down下项目,就是无法启动项目,这种情况经常存在,
不是任何情况都有一个配好所有环境,安装好SVN项目的机器给你,
你就懂Commit与Update to HEAD还真不行。
有时候不是公司给的机器的问题,而是你从SVN刚刚Down下来的项目还没有弄好。
在启动SVN项目之前,请注意一下几点:
1、确定这WEB工程到底最初是用Eclipse写的还是MyEclipse写的?这工程根据哪个软件开发就用哪个软件接着开发。其实Eclipse和MyEclipse的操作都差不多,Eclipse与MyEclipse的项目互通还要做工作,也就是说彼此之间写的工程彼此之间还无法一键编译,个人更希望最初的开发是根据Eclipse来的,这东西不卡,官方,但人家是根据MyEclipse建立,你就接着继续写。
2、MyEclipse的版本是否有问题,如果一些工程是在MyEclipse8.6上面写的,或者曾经被MyEclipse8.6编辑过,你用Myeclipse6.5可能会遭遇到这样那样的问题……
3、上面两部还是小事,以下的工作必须认真检查与进行。首先在Window->Preferences,然后在搜索框输入Tomcat,选择你的SVN在服务器上运行的版本,配置好相应版本的Tomcat,然后检查Tomcat服务Tomcat server是否打开,Tomcat的路径是否正确?
4、Tomcat旗下的JDK是否选择为一个官方的JDK,而不是Eclipse/MyEclipse自带的JDK,Eclipse/MyEclipse自带的JDK版本太低,一般无法驾驭某些Javaweb插件,你应该从Java官网下载JDK1.7兼容现阶段几乎所有版本的J***A代码,当然超过JDK1.5就没问题,只是现在已经找不到JDK1.7以下的JDK下载了。《【Java】JDK的下载、安装与部署》(点击打开链接)。同时Tomcat的JDK启动配置加上:-server
-Xms256m -Xmx1024m -XX:PermSize=64M -XX:MaxPermSize=128m了吗?否则一些大型的WEB工程由于JVM,Java虚拟机的内存限制而导致无法运行。
5、右击你编辑的工程,选择属性Properties,编码请改成你的WEB工程的编码,一般自带的编码不是UTF-8,这一点请注意。(不要问我为何涂抹了图片的一些地方,公司机密,你懂的!)
6、之后到Java Build Path,本工程的编译JDK是否有调好,同样改成JDK1.7或者JDK1.6,而不是Eclipse/MyEclipse自带的JDK。这一步是最容易遗忘的一步。很多人潜意识就认为上面改完Tomcat的JDK就可以了,没有注意到这一步,结果在启动工程时,遇到“An internal error occurred during: "Add Deployment". java.lang.NullPointException”的错误,想一辈子都想不明白!
7、最后,如果你本地数据库的密码与服务器上的数据库密码不一致的时候,你通过Ctrl+H,选择File Search,把工程中代码涉及服务器上的密码的地方,搜索所有文件*.*,通过下面的Replace替换成你本地的服务器密码。
8、最后,在Eclipse/MyEclipse下面的Servers界面,添加你刚才弄好的工程,再启动Tomcat服务器,不要直接点击上面的运行按钮,这又不是J***A工程!
但是,往往有时候前台环境配置好了,《【Javaweb】前台开发环境的配置Myeclipse6.5+JDK1.6+Tomcat6.0+SVN1.8》(点击打开链接),后台环境配置好,《【Mysql】Mysql的安装、部署与图形化》(点击打开链接),各步骤都做好了,根据上面给的SVN从服务器按照要求Down下项目,就是无法启动项目,这种情况经常存在,
不是任何情况都有一个配好所有环境,安装好SVN项目的机器给你,
你就懂Commit与Update to HEAD还真不行。
有时候不是公司给的机器的问题,而是你从SVN刚刚Down下来的项目还没有弄好。
在启动SVN项目之前,请注意一下几点:
1、确定这WEB工程到底最初是用Eclipse写的还是MyEclipse写的?这工程根据哪个软件开发就用哪个软件接着开发。其实Eclipse和MyEclipse的操作都差不多,Eclipse与MyEclipse的项目互通还要做工作,也就是说彼此之间写的工程彼此之间还无法一键编译,个人更希望最初的开发是根据Eclipse来的,这东西不卡,官方,但人家是根据MyEclipse建立,你就接着继续写。
2、MyEclipse的版本是否有问题,如果一些工程是在MyEclipse8.6上面写的,或者曾经被MyEclipse8.6编辑过,你用Myeclipse6.5可能会遭遇到这样那样的问题……
3、上面两部还是小事,以下的工作必须认真检查与进行。首先在Window->Preferences,然后在搜索框输入Tomcat,选择你的SVN在服务器上运行的版本,配置好相应版本的Tomcat,然后检查Tomcat服务Tomcat server是否打开,Tomcat的路径是否正确?
4、Tomcat旗下的JDK是否选择为一个官方的JDK,而不是Eclipse/MyEclipse自带的JDK,Eclipse/MyEclipse自带的JDK版本太低,一般无法驾驭某些Javaweb插件,你应该从Java官网下载JDK1.7兼容现阶段几乎所有版本的J***A代码,当然超过JDK1.5就没问题,只是现在已经找不到JDK1.7以下的JDK下载了。《【Java】JDK的下载、安装与部署》(点击打开链接)。同时Tomcat的JDK启动配置加上:-server
-Xms256m -Xmx1024m -XX:PermSize=64M -XX:MaxPermSize=128m了吗?否则一些大型的WEB工程由于JVM,Java虚拟机的内存限制而导致无法运行。
5、右击你编辑的工程,选择属性Properties,编码请改成你的WEB工程的编码,一般自带的编码不是UTF-8,这一点请注意。(不要问我为何涂抹了图片的一些地方,公司机密,你懂的!)
6、之后到Java Build Path,本工程的编译JDK是否有调好,同样改成JDK1.7或者JDK1.6,而不是Eclipse/MyEclipse自带的JDK。这一步是最容易遗忘的一步。很多人潜意识就认为上面改完Tomcat的JDK就可以了,没有注意到这一步,结果在启动工程时,遇到“An internal error occurred during: "Add Deployment". java.lang.NullPointException”的错误,想一辈子都想不明白!
7、最后,如果你本地数据库的密码与服务器上的数据库密码不一致的时候,你通过Ctrl+H,选择File Search,把工程中代码涉及服务器上的密码的地方,搜索所有文件*.*,通过下面的Replace替换成你本地的服务器密码。
8、最后,在Eclipse/MyEclipse下面的Servers界面,添加你刚才弄好的工程,再启动Tomcat服务器,不要直接点击上面的运行按钮,这又不是J***A工程!
相关文章推荐
- SVN上传文件注意事项-------------------养成良好的项目文件上传习惯
- PhpStorm 9.03 集成 开源中国(oschina.net)的Git项目,提交SVN时注意事项
- 搭建SVN及项目上传注意事项
- SVN 管理Android项目中eclipse的设置和注意事项
- Eclipse中从SVN下载Maven项目注意事项
- 东软JavaWeb实训记-DAY7-小组项目开发实践(c:ForEach+SVN共享+开发流程+注意事项)
- SVN 管理Android项目中eclipse的设置和注意事项
- svn 提交iOS项目注意事项(工具:cornerstone)
- SVN 管理Android项目中eclipse的设置和注意事项
- 用svn管理项目时,复制文件的注意事项
- 从svn检出项目的注意事项
- 新手通过SVN向eclipse中导入项目注意事项
- cocos2dx项目使用svn注意事项
- SVN上传文件注意事项-------------------养成良好的项目文件上传习惯
- SVN上传文件注意事项-------------------养成良好的项目文件上传习惯
- PhpStorm 集成 开源中国(oschina.net)的Git项目,提交SVN时注意事项
- 项目中svn使用的一些注意事项(新手)
- vs2005的windows项目中复制Form文件的步骤和注意事项
- 使用SVN提交工程需要注意和遵循的事项
- 做一个网站搜索引擎优化项目的注意事项